Janelle Monáe questioned Kate Hudson about the many co-stars she’s kissed over the years for a Vanity Fair lie detector interview. When Hudson revealed that her “Almost Famous” co-star Billy Cudrup was a less aggressive kisser than Matthew McConaughey, she came up with a hilarious way to describe the wet ones that the Texan has planted on her: “like Longhorns.” Of Cudrup, she recalled, “It’s a more sophisticated version of a kiss. You know, it’s like theater. It’s like Stansislavski.”
But according to Hudson, neither actor can top her “Dr. T & the Women” castmate Liv Tyler. “She has the softest lips of them all,” Hudson gushed. She did, however, confess to having a big regret about their lip-lock, revealing that the two kept it chaste instead of full-on making out. If she could do it again, she’d dial up the passion. Tyler feels the same way about the scene. In a 2008 interview with Metro, she explained why they both held back, saying, “We were always so shy about the kissing but in retrospect, we were like: ‘We so should have just totally made out and tongued each other.’ But we never did, we were just too scared to do it.”

While Tyler ranks high on Hudson’s list, in a 2014 appearance on “Watch What Happens Live,” Hudson said that her best-ever kissing scene was with Heath Ledger, whom she appeared with in the 2002 drama “The Four Feathers.”
